> One of the implications of the original quantlib algorithm is that an
> option that pays out $5 on an underlying spot price of 100 will be
> valued differently than an option that pays out 5% on underlying spot
> price of $100.

this seems perfect to me. it's different if you have an announced
official discrete dividend of 5$ or if you have a generic estimated
dividend of 5%.

> The original quantlib algorithm backward evolves the price curve and if
> it encounters a dividend payout of $N, it shifts the price curve by N.
>
> The new algorithm which matches the results in the analytic formula and
> the "classic dividend" formula, first calculates the discounted dividend
> payout and then it scales the price curve by a factor of (U+N)/U where U
> is the price of the underlying.

The classic analityc formula you are referring to only handles 5%
dividend, finite differences can handle both 5% and 5$. The key point
in both cases is which vol a trader will use.

I personally would love FD to handle both percentage and absolute
dividends. Anway for short dated options the discrete case is probably
the most relevant.
